Key Components of an Effective Voicemail Message
The better leave a voicemail message should be professional, informative and to the point. This is the make-or-break in mobility, and moving parts are Keep reading for key elements!
1. Greeting
Introduce yourself in a friendly, professional manner When initiating a chat, personalize the message and make it sound human by using your own name or our company’s. For example:
”Good afternoon this is [Your Name] calling with……(your company/miscellaneous details).
2. Purpose of the Voicemail
Tell the caller in no uncertain terms that she has, indeed reached your voicemail. This allows agents to be more aware of what will happen and helpful for the caller who needs to leave a message. For example:
Sorry I just missed your call.
3. Availability
Let the caller know when you’ll be free or what a good time to call back is. This gives them an idea of when they might expect a call-back. For example:
Sorry, I am not here right now but your call is always important to me.
4. Instructions for the Caller
Clear ways of saying what the caller should go away on his or her message. This makes sure that you will have all the needed specifics to reply your speak with very efficiently. For example:
Leave a name, number and brief message, I will return the call shortly.
5. Thank You and Sign-Off
Finish the message with a thank you and courteous closing This will lead the caller to feel good. For example:
“Thank you for calling. Have a great day!”

Tips for Creating an Effective Voicemail Message

1. Keep It Short and Sweet
Aim for a 20-30 second long voicemail This way, the caller has all of the information that they need but will not be frustrated by a long message.
2. Use a Professional Tone
A Personal voicemail, however still be professional. This shows you some respect and adds to their positive picture.
3. Smile While You Speak
Record your voicemail smiling It will make you sound friendlier and easier to get a hold of. A small change that can transform your communication.
4. Avoid Background Noise
Always record your voicemail in a place where clarity can be maintained This background noise will be at least a distraction to your message, and often times it can make you hard to understand as the audio quality now plays second fiddle behind this din of extra stuff on top.
5. Update Your Message Regularly
Change your voicemail to reflect you are unavailable or out of the office By staying up to date with your message, you are simply showing that you give a damn about the other party.
6. Use a Script
Even if you are good at a job off the cuff, it can still be helpful to use scripts as this ensures that key information is not forgotten. Writing out your message and talking it through a few times can help.
7. Test Your Message
Finally, do a test (call you number from another device) before saving your voicemail. Hear the tone to make sure it is clear, presentable and void of any or accuracy errors.

What should voicemail say?
You will want to provide a simple greeting, let the caller know they are reaching your voicemail inbox, when you can call them back along with what information would be helpful for any callback message by asking them to say their name and number and brief msg then signing off politely. This saves you from a voicemail that is too short or sounds unprofessional and does not provide sufficient information for the person calling.
What not to say in a voicemail?
Avoid leaving overly long or confusing messages, and never share sensitive or confidential information in a voicemail. Keep the message clear, concise, and professional to ensure effective communication.
